To a CE person C is a high level language. Arrch. •. CpE is better for hardware jobs, and lower level programming. CS is better for application, web, mobile, etc. The degree itself, however, won't be any sort of limiting factor. In other words, employers won't turn you away because you have CS over CpE, or vice versa.

Keep in mind that CE is in the School of Engineering, while CS is part of the School of Arts and Sciences. This dictates what your general education requirements will be, so CE will have more math, physics, and other engineering-related classes required than CS. In terms of jobs, both are pretty similar. If SWE is your goal, either one works. CE lacks rigor in comparison to EE, yet the rigor gap is even wider when CS is compared to CE.
